模擬退火算法求解TSP問題

模擬退火算法求解TSP問題

ID:41177491

大?。?21.50 KB

頁數(shù):21頁

時間:2019-08-18

模擬退火算法求解TSP問題_第1頁
模擬退火算法求解TSP問題_第2頁
模擬退火算法求解TSP問題_第3頁
模擬退火算法求解TSP問題_第4頁
模擬退火算法求解TSP問題_第5頁
資源描述:

《模擬退火算法求解TSP問題》由會員上傳分享,免費在線閱讀,更多相關內(nèi)容在學術論文-天天文庫。

1、模擬退火算法在TSP問題中的應用研究摘要旅行商問題,即TSP問題(TravelingSalesmanProblem)又譯為旅行推銷員問題、貨郎擔問題,是數(shù)學領域中著名問題之一。TSP問題是一個典型的NP完全問題,模擬退火算法是求解此問題的一種比較理想的方法。模擬退火算法是迭代求解策略的一種隨機尋優(yōu)算法,TSP問題即旅行商問題是一個組合優(yōu)化問題,該問題被證明具有NPC計算復雜性。因此,研究模擬退化算法的基本原理及其在TSP問題求解中的應用受到高度的關注。本文主要闡述了模擬退火算法的原理以及退火算法在函數(shù)優(yōu)化問題上的應用和優(yōu)化組合問題的研究,以便來了解TSP問題以及如何應用模擬退火算法解

2、決實際問題上,幫助理解模擬退化算法的基本原理及其在TSP問題求解中的應用。關鍵詞模擬退火算法;TSP;NPC;組合優(yōu)化1模擬退火算法在TSP問題中的應用研究ABSTRACTIntoTSPproblem,theproblemoftravellingmerchants(travelingsalesman)andtheproblemoftravellingcanvasserventerlastproblem,theproblem,inthefieldofmathematics.TSPproblemfamousoneproblemisatypicalNP,impersonateallanne

3、alingalgorithmisthesolutionoftheproblemofaratheridealmethod.SimulationofannealingthealgorithmisnotaniterativethesolutionofarandomTSPproblem,thisalgorithmforthetravelcompanyisacombinationofoptimizationproblem.ThequestionwasshowntothecomplexityoftheNPC.Thus,researchondegradationisthebasicprincipl

4、eoftheTSPproblemandsolutionoftheapplicationbyahighdegreeofconcern.Thisarticlefocusesontheprincipleofsimulatedannealingalgorithmandsomeoftheknowledgestructurewhatassociatedwiththefirstpoint.Bystudyingtheprincipleoftheiralgorithm,simulatedannealingalgorithmtooptimizetheapplicationfunction,andopti

5、mizationofresearchtounderstandtheproblemandthesimulatedannealingalgorithmforTSPThepracticalapplicationandresearch.HelptounderstandthebasicprinciplesofsimulatedannealingalgorithmanditsapplicationinsolvingTSPproblems.KEYWORDSSAA;TSP;NPC;CombinatorialOptimization1模擬退火算法在TSP問題中的應用研究1模擬退火算法在TSP問題中的應

6、用研究目錄摘要IABSTRACTII第一章引言21.1TSP問題的基本概念21.2模擬退火算法的背景21.3發(fā)展前景3第二章2.1模擬退火算法的原理42.1.1模擬退火的基本思想42.1.2算法對應動態(tài)演示步驟42.2TSP問題簡述5第三章問題描述與算法分析研究63.1應用研究整體規(guī)劃63.2應用開發(fā)環(huán)境63.2.1開發(fā)語言63.2.2開發(fā)平臺63.3TSP問題的描述和分析73.4模擬退火算法的分析73.4.1模擬退火算法模型73.4.2模擬退火算法與優(yōu)化問題分析83.5應用研究方案分析8第四章算法具體設計與編碼實現(xiàn)94.1基于模擬退火算法求解TSP問題詳細設計94.1.1求解TSP

7、問題的模擬退火算法及流程圖94.1.2主要代碼11第五章算法運行分析135.1運行界面圖示135.2運行結果15第六章結束語16致謝17參考文獻181模擬退火算法在TSP問題中的應用研究19模擬退火算法在TSP問題中的應用研究引言旅行商問題(TravelingSalesmanProblem,TSP)可描述為:已知N個城市之間的相互距離,現(xiàn)有一推銷員必須遍訪這N個城市,并且每個城市只能訪問一次,最后又必須返回出發(fā)城市。如何安排他對這些城市的訪問次序,使其旅行

當前文檔最多預覽五頁,下載文檔查看全文

此文檔下載收益歸作者所有

當前文檔最多預覽五頁,下載文檔查看全文
溫馨提示:
1. 部分包含數(shù)學公式或PPT動畫的文件,查看預覽時可能會顯示錯亂或異常,文件下載后無此問題,請放心下載。
2. 本文檔由用戶上傳,版權歸屬用戶,天天文庫負責整理代發(fā)布。如果您對本文檔版權有爭議請及時聯(lián)系客服。
3. 下載前請仔細閱讀文檔內(nèi)容,確認文檔內(nèi)容符合您的需求后進行下載,若出現(xiàn)內(nèi)容與標題不符可向本站投訴處理。
4. 下載文檔時可能由于網(wǎng)絡波動等原因無法下載或下載錯誤,付費完成后未能成功下載的用戶請聯(lián)系客服處理。